Sentence Mode

Full sentences with punctuation and spacing. This mode tests real-world typing skills — including capitalization, punctuation, and multiple words in sequence. Matching is case- and punctuation-insensitive, so focus on getting the words right. Scores are 4x higher than Word Mode to reflect the challenge.

Story Mode

A campaign of 12 levels with unique objectives: destroy a target number of words, survive for a set time, or complete precision challenges. Each level has unique word pools and difficulty settings. Beat levels to unlock the next stage.

Daily Challenge

Every day, a fresh seeded word list is generated from the current date. Everyone gets the exact same words. You have 2 minutes to score as high as possible. Play daily to build your streak and compete for the daily high score.

Pro Tips for High Scores

  1. Prioritize accuracy over speed. A missed word resets your combo to zero. The combo multiplier is where the big points come from.
  2. Go for Dare words. They give 3x points. Even if they're longer, the risk is usually worth it.
  3. Use the Enter key strategically. If you start typing the wrong word, press Enter to clear your input instantly and start fresh.
  4. Chain words together. Chain words give 1.5x points and keep appearing as long as your streak holds. Build on them.
  5. Save shields for the endgame. At 25x and 50x combo, you earn shields. Use them to push through the hardest moments without resetting your combo.
  6. Play Daily Challenges. The seeded word list means fair competition — everyone faces the same challenge. Plus, streaks earn you bragging rights.

How the Leaderboard Works

Scores are submitted to a global leaderboard for Word and Sentence modes. Only Hard difficulty (Word mode) and Sentence mode scores are submitted to the leaderboard to ensure fair comparison. You'll be prompted to enter a name when submitting a high score.
